Not sure if srs.
You replied while i was editing my comment haha :p what i meant was that because of the aligning process, it is much easier to get a band 5 or higher in advanced than in standard. for example last year raw mark of 68/105 in advanced was an 81 HSC mark, whereas standard, the raw mark was much higher

Definitely go for advanced, standard aligns horribly (5% get above 80 compared to like 40% or 50% for advanced) and the difference in difficulty is marginal.
